Maxim M. Bespalov is a scholar working on Cellular and Molecular Neuroscience, Molecular Biology and Cell Biology. According to data from OpenAlex, Maxim M. Bespalov has authored 21 papers receiving a total of 968 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Cellular and Molecular Neuroscience, 12 papers in Molecular Biology and 4 papers in Cell Biology. Recurrent topics in Maxim M. Bespalov’s work include Nerve injury and regeneration (11 papers), Signaling Pathways in Disease (5 papers) and Neurogenesis and neuroplasticity mechanisms (4 papers). Maxim M. Bespalov is often cited by papers focused on Nerve injury and regeneration (11 papers), Signaling Pathways in Disease (5 papers) and Neurogenesis and neuroplasticity mechanisms (4 papers). Maxim M. Bespalov collaborates with scholars based in Finland, Estonia and United States. Maxim M. Bespalov's co-authors include Märt Saarma, Yulia Sidorova, Heikki Rauvala, Mikhail Paveliev, Finny S. Varghese, Pia Runeberg‐Roos, Pasi Kaukinen, Leena Hanski, Krister Wennerberg and Tero Ahola and has published in prestigious journals such as Journal of Biological Chemistry, Nature Communications and The Journal of Cell Biology.
